Frank heralds ´big win´ for Spurs in Champions League opener

Thomas Frank heralded a “big win” for his Tottenham team after they edged out Villarreal 1-0 in their opening Champions League fixture.

The deadlock was broken inside just four minutes at Tottenham Hotspur Stadium, when a goalkeeping blunder from Luiz Junior saw him inexplicably turn the ball into his own net, after trying to deal with a Lucas Bergvall cross.

Yet the early goal did not spark a flurry of goalmouth action. Indeed, there was just one shot on target from the two teams combined, taken by Pape Matar Sarr for Spurs in the 30th minute.

This is just the second Champions League game involving a Premier League or LaLiga team to have one or fewer shots on target, the first being Chelsea’s 0-0 draw with Sparta Prague in November 2003.

The defeat ensured that Villarreal remain winless in all of their five opening Champions League matches, drawing three and losing twice.
